Transverse Modes and Frequency Selective Loss Function of a Resonator Composed of a Cylindrical Mirror and a Diffraction Grating
An open resonator composed of a cylindrical mirror and a diffraction grating centering at the wavelength of 10.6 μm is investigated by utilizing the Fox-Li iterative method. The near and far field distributions of the eigenmodes and frequency selective loss function are calculated numerically.
